lets have it for Norwegians!

Temperatures:

+15°C / 59°F This is as warm as it gets in Norway, so we'll start here. People in Portugal wear winter-coats and gloves. The Norwegians are out in the sun, getting a tan.

+10°C / 50°F The French are trying in vain to start their central heating. The Norwegians plant flowers in their gardens.

+5°C / 41°F Italian cars won't start. The Norwegians are cruising in cabriolets.

0°C / 32°F Distilled water freezes. The water in Oslo Fjord gets a little thicker.

-5°C / 23°F People in California almost freeze to death. The Norwegians have their final
barbecue before winter.

-10°C / 14°F The Brits start the heat in their houses. The Norwegians start using long sleeves.

-20°C / -4°F The Aussies flee from Mallorca. The Norwegians end their Midsummer celebrations. Autumn is here.

-30°C / -22°F People in Greece die from the cold and disappear from the face of the earth. The Norwegians start drying their laundry indoors.

-40°C / -40°F Paris start cracking in the cold. The Norwegians stand in line at the hotdog stands.

-50°C / -58°F Polar bears start evacuating the North Pole. The Norwegian army postpones their winter survival training awaiting real winter weather.

-70°C / -94°F The false Santa moves south. The Norwegian army goes out on winter survival training.

-183°C / -297.4°F Microbes in food don't survive. The Norwegian cows complain that the farmers' hands are cold.

-273°C / -459.4°F ALL atomic and subatomic particle movent halts. The Norwegians start saying "Faen, it's cold outside today."

-300°C / -508°F Hell freezes over, Norway wins the Eurovision Song Contest.
